What is the past tense of shudder?

What's the past tense of shudder? Here's the word you're looking for.

Answer

The past tense of shudder is shuddered.

The third-person singular simple present indicative form of shudder is shudders.

The present participle of shudder is shuddering.

The past participle of shudder is shuddered.
